Why a Renovation Loan?

A renovation loan mortgage combines the cost of buying or refinancing a home with the funds needed for renovations, allowing homeowners to finance both in a single loan.

Overview of Renovation Loans

A renovation loan is designed for homeowners or buyers looking to make major repairs or upgrades to a property. Unlike standard home improvement loans that usually cover smaller projects, renovation loans provide financing for larger, more extensive renovations — making it possible to transform a home while managing costs under one loan.

A Renovation loan is a loan backed by the federal government and given to buyers who want to buy a damaged or older home and do repairs on it. Here’s how it works: Let’s say you want to buy a home that needs a brand-new bathroom and kitchen. A lender would then give you the money to buy (or refinance) the house plus the money to do the necessary renovations to the kitchen and bathroom.

Often the loan will also include: 1) an up to 20% contingency reserve so that you will have the funds to complete the remodel in the event it ends up costing more than the estimates suggested and/or 2) a provision that gives you up to about six months of mortgage payments so you can live elsewhere while you’re remodeling, but still pay the mortgage payments on the new home.
